Hermes 2 Pro Model: A Flexible AI Framework
Model Summary
Hermes 2 Pro, built on the Llama-3 8B structure, is an advanced version of the original Hermes 2. It has been revised with an modernized and sanitized OpenHermes 2.5 Dataset and includes new Function Calling and JSON Mode datasets created internally. This system stands out at routine activities, chat functions, and is particularly strong in function calling and formatted JSON responses.

Main Features
API Execution and JSON Replies: Hermes 2 Pro Model attains a 90% on API call evaluation and 84% on formatted JSON response assessment. This renders it highly reliable for tasks demanding these precise responses.
Exclusive Tokens: The system includes specific tokens for agent functionalities, augmenting its analysis while processing tokens.
ChatML Formatting: Hermes 2 Pro utilizes the ChatML prompt format, comparable to OpenAI's, which facilitates for organized multi-turn exchanges.

OpenChat Platform: Pushing Forward Open-source Language Models
Overview of the Model
OpenChat Model, originating from the Llama-3-Instruct model, provides a solid framework for coding, conversation, and general functionalities. The platform is created to perform well in numerous benchmarks, rendering it a leading player in the open-source AI domain.

Primary Features
High Performance: OpenChat models are tuned for high performance and can operate smoothly on standard GPUs with 24GB RAM.
OpenAI Integration: The system reacts for calls aligned with OpenAI ChatCompletion API specifications, rendering incorporation simple for developers acquainted with OpenAI tools.
Versatile Templates: OpenChat provides default and custom templates, improving its applicability for diverse operations.

Featherless AI: Accessing Hugging Face AI Systems
Platform Description
Featherless.ai endeavors to streamline access to a vast selection of models from Hugging Face. It resolves the difficulties of downloading and deploying large models on graphics cards, providing a economical and user-friendly alternative.

Key Features
Broad Model Access: Users can execute over 450 Hugging Face models with a affordable plan.
Custom Inference Infrastructure: Featherless AI leverages a specifically designed inference system that dynamically adjusts according to model demand, ensuring optimal resource management.
Security of Data: The platform prioritizes data protection and data confidentiality, with no logging of user inputs and outputs.
